In today's digital age, children are growing up surrounded by Internet of Things (IoT) technology that has revolutionized the way they play games. While these advancements have undoubtedly brought numerous benefits and opportunities for learning and entertainment, they have also raised important questions about etiquette and courtesy in the digital realm. **1. The rise of connected toys and games:** IoT technology has paved the way for a new generation of interactive toys and games that can connect to the internet and other devices. Children can now play with smart toys that respond to their actions or engage in multiplayer online games with friends from around the world. **2. Teaching digital etiquette:** With the increasing integration of IoT technology into children's games, it is crucial for parents and educators to teach digital etiquette and courtesy. Children need to understand the importance of being respectful towards others online, practicing good sportsmanship, and protecting their personal information when playing connected games. **3. Balancing screen time:** The abundance of IoT-powered games and devices can lead to children spending more time in front of screens. It is essential for parents to set limits on screen time and encourage children to engage in a variety of offline activities that promote social interaction and physical exercise. **4. Monitoring online interactions:** As children interact with others in online games, parents should monitor their behavior and ensure they are practicing kindness and respect towards fellow players. It is important for children to understand that their words and actions online can have real-world consequences. **5. Encouraging creativity and critical thinking:** While IoT technology offers exciting opportunities for children to engage with innovative games, it is essential to also encourage creativity and critical thinking. Parents can support their children in exploring different types of games that promote problem-solving skills and creativity. In conclusion, the integration of IoT technology into children's games presents both exciting opportunities and challenges for promoting etiquette and courtesy. By fostering a balance between online and offline activities, teaching digital etiquette, and encouraging creativity and critical thinking, parents can help children navigate the digital world with respect and kindness.
